Read full postDescribed as ‘Hertfordshire’s hedonist hideaway’, Pendley Manor is a romantic retreat surrounded by 35 acres of grounds and gardens. Its historic architecture and immaculate lawns provide the perfect setting for relaxed escapism. New to Spabreaks.com this year, here’s what you need to know.
A sumptuous Grade II listed manor house in Hertfordshire, Pendley Manor is a red brick sophisticated Tudor revival property with more than 1000 years of history to its site. Perfect for elegant staycations, it is all high ceilings and regal grandeur. The range of rooms and suites go from Classic Doubles in the Manor House itself to elaborate suites, some of which are located in more contemporary buildings within the grounds.
The award-winning Oak Restaurant serves delectable British fare in quintessential country house surroundings. Food is about taste as well as impeccable presentation, however for something a little more relaxed, there’s also the Peacock Lounge for light meals and drinks. This light conservatory space is where plush furnishings with floral details sit under a majestic chandelier; and the room brings the outside in.
The combination of leisure facilities and spa treatments is the cherry on top of a hotel break at Pendley Manor. Work out in the Life Fitness gym, take a dip in the tranquil lap pool, revive with a sauna and steam or relax in the Jacuzzi. In treatment rooms they also offer a variety of face and body therapies using the ESPA and Jessica product lines. From prescription facials and aromatherapy massages to manicures and pedicures, the spa is all about indulgence and tailoring treatments to suit your needs. Choose from Lava Shell massages or reflexology, then complete your spa day with a restorative healthy lunch, designed with wellbeing in mind.
Set in 35 acres of grounds and immaculate lawns, the scene is set for a relaxing break. The grounds are also ideal for summer staycation activities including strolls in the sunshine and reading in peace and quiet. There’s also ample opportunity to play a round of croquet on the lawn or visit a nearby golf course. If you ask at reception they can also give you a list of specialist partners who can offer archery, go-karting or even hot air ballooning nearby.
Pendley Manor’s easy going atmosphere, vast amount of space and range of experiences makes it perfect for lots of different occasions and visitors. It’s history, style, food and service makes it perfect for romantic escapes. However, the space and activities make it ideal for groups of friends and with family rooms available as well as all that space outside for children to run around, it’s ideal for families.
